Southwest Indian art is probably the most distinctive and best known of Native American artistic traditions. Native American pottery is a craft that has been handed down and perfected for thousands of years. Experts believe that Native American pottery started being made roughly 2,000 years ago. Indonesia is a very creative country in terms of handicrafts. Bali especially stands testimony to this beautiful craftsmanship. Balinese art is the art of Hindu-Javanese origin that grew from the work of artisans of the Majapahit Kingdom, with their expansion to Bali in the late 14th century.
